About the Book

In As Time Goes By in Hell, Cynthia Wells redefines the universal concept of hell and weaves a gripping satire of violence, sex, betrayal and retribution.

The book revolves around two beautiful cousins, Veronica Howard and Kristen Leigh Abbott, who are leading members of Houston society. Although polar opposites, the two are bound by an innate, almost obsessive love for each other after they rise above poverty and survive sexual abuse. Veronica becomes one of the best defense lawyers in Houston, while Kristen uses the money of her four millionaire husbands to surgically enhance what nature had already given her. The lives of the pair are irrevocably altered when handsome and seductive lawyer Jason Ross returns to town. As a teenage victim, he had once captured Veronica’s sympathy in the most brutal case of her career. Murders, romantic triangles and shocking revelations are newly brewing and these result in unforgivable sins that send one cousin to burn in Hell. There she is forced to glimpse those she loved and whom she thought loved her, hurting all over again, only in a constant barrage of video replays.

With its intriguing characters and a gripping storyline, As Time Goes By in Hell will keep readers turning the pages until the final revelation is made.

All proceeds from the sale of this novel will be donated to the American Cancer Society, in loving memory of the author’s brother Gene and others who died to soon.


About the Author

Cynthia Wells recently retired from a forty-three year aerospace career supporting the NASA Johnson Spaceflight Center in Houston, where she managed the Shuttle and Space Station flight controllers. She read romance novels as a way of diffusing the tensions of space flight and deflating budgets. Her family never liked hearing those “boring” NASA space flight stories or appreciated her love of old movies. Maybe the sex and violence in this satirical romance will entertain them. Cynthia lives in Pearland, Texas with her husband of over forty years, Joe Wells. They are daily entertained by their miniature schnauzer Zach. Her only daughter Kristen has only been married once and definitely not to a millionaire.
